Руководство по созданию чат-бота для анонсов мероприятий и записи на них

Руководство по созданию чат-бота для анонсов мероприятий и записи на них

В этой статье мы рассмотрим, как создать чат-бота, который будет автоматически анонсировать мероприятия, собирать заявки на участие и отправлять напоминания о событиях.
Мы будем использовать конструктор ботов BotBrother, который позволяет создавать ботов без необходимости писать код.

Зачем нужен чат-бот для анонсов мероприятий?

Чат-бот для анонсов мероприятий и записи на них может существенно упростить множество задач.
Вот несколько причин, по которым стоит создать такого бота:

Автоматизация: бот может автоматически уведомлять участников о предстоящих событиях.
Сбор заявок: участники могут записаться на мероприятие, не выходя из чата, что снижает вероятность пропуска важной информации.
Управление регистрацией: бот может собирать контактные данные участников, отправлять им напоминания и подтверждения.
Удобство для пользователей: чат-боты предоставляют быстрые ответы на вопросы, упрощают процесс записи и помогают не забыть о событиях.
Экономия времени: автоматизация процессов регистрации и рассылки анонсов освобождает организаторов от рутины.

Шаги по созданию чат-бота для анонсов

1. Создание чат-бота

  1. Создаём бота в Телеграм через @Botfather (инструкция).
  2. Оформляем бота Телеграм в @Botfather (инструкция).
  3. Привязываем бота Телеграм к нашей платформе BotBrother (инструкция).
  4. Создаём приветственное сообщение (инструкция).

2. Создание логики чат-бота

Чат-бот для анонсов мероприятий и записи на них должен выполнять несколько ключевых задач:

  1. Приветственное сообщение.
    • Бот начинает общение с приветствием и объяснением своей функции. Например:
    «Привет! Я твой помощник по записи на мероприятия. Здесь ты можешь узнать о предстоящих событиях и зарегистрироваться на них».
  2. Анонс мероприятий
    • Бот предоставляет пользователю информацию о доступных мероприятиях (например, вебинарах, тренингах, мастер-классах), сообщая название, время, место и условия участия.
    «Скоро у нас будет вебинар по маркетингу. Он состоится 20 декабря в 15:00. Ты хочешь зарегистрироваться?»
  3. Запрос на регистрацию
    • Бот предлагает пользователю зарегистрироваться на выбранное мероприятие, собирая необходимые данные (например, имя и контактные данные).
    «Для регистрации на вебинар, пожалуйста, введите свое имя и контактный номер».
  4. Подтверждение регистрации
    • После получения данных от пользователя, бот подтверждает регистрацию и отправляет информацию о мероприятии.
    «Спасибо за регистрацию! Вы успешно записались на вебинар по маркетингу, который состоится 20 декабря в 15:00. Мы отправим вам напоминание за день до мероприятия».
  5. Напоминания о мероприятии.
    • Бот автоматически отправляет напоминания о предстоящем мероприятии за определённое время до его начала (например, за день или несколько часов).
    «Напоминаем, что завтра в 15:00 начнется вебинар по маркетингу. Не забудь присоединиться!»
  6. Обратная связь и дополнительные материалы.
    • После мероприятия бот может запросить отзыв о мероприятии или отправить дополнительные материалы, например, запись вебинара или презентацию.
    “Спасибо, что приняли участие в вебинаре! Поделитесь своими впечатлениями, оставив короткий отзыв. Вот ссылка на запись вебинара и дополнительные материалы: [ссылка].”
  7. Хранение и аналитика.
    • Все собранные данные о пользователях, их регистрации и предпочтениях сохраняются в базе данных для дальнейшего анализа.
    • С помощью аналитики можно отслеживать популярность мероприятий, количество регистраций, а также улучшать процессы напоминаний и сбора отзывов.
Руководство по созданию чат-бота для анонсов мероприятий и записи на них

Как реализовать такую логику в структуре бота:

  1. Заходим в нашего бота в сервисе BotBrother (ссылка).
  2. Переходим в структуру нашего бота → Кликаем по кнопке “Добавить новую рубрику”, называем и сохраняем её.

    Инструкция по созданию списка рубрик, рубрик и действий.
  3. Создаём действие в нашей созданной рубрике, нажав на кнопку “Добавить действие” → Выбираем “Текстовый выбор” → Редактируем действие: называем его для своего удобства, задаём сообщение перед кнопками выбора (например, “На неделе у нас запланировано несколько мероприятий, про какое рассказать вам подробнее?”), заполняем сами кнопки выбора (Например, по маркетингу/по финансам/по продажам и тд.) Сохраняем.

    Более подробная инструкция как сделать сообщение с кнопками.
  4. Создаём переменные данные, в которых будет храниться информация о выборе пользователя, нажав на “Дополнения” в верхней панели → Кликаем по кнопке “Переменные данные” → Кликаем по кнопке “Добавить новые переменные данные” → Даём название и выбираем тип “Обычные” → Нажимаем кнопку “Добавить”.

    Переменные данные создаём для квалификации интереса пользователя (маркетинг/финансы/продажи и тд.), а также для контактных данных (достаточно сделать для ФИО, номер телефона отобразится без переменных данных).
  5. Возвращаемся в редактирование нашего действия “Текстовый выбор” → Нажимаем на свитчер “Сохранить результаты выбора в переменных данных” → Выбираем список и наши переменные данные, в которых хотим зафиксировать выбор пользователя → Сохраняем.

    Для одного текстового действия предназначены одни переменные данные.
  6. Для удобства создаём рубрику под каждое мероприятие (см. инструкцию из пункта 1).
  7. Далее в каждой из рубрик создаём действия с анонсом мероприятия.
    Действия могут быть:
    • Текстовое поле – если в сообщении будет только текст (можно добавить ссылку в текст, например, на YouTube или VKВидео).
    Как работает: Нажимаем в рубрике на кнопку “Добавить действие” → Выбираем “Текстовое поле”, вставляем и форматируем текст → Сохраняем.
    • Картинка/Видео/Аудио – если кроме текста нужно вставить картинку/видео/аудио.
    Как работает: Нажимаем в рубрике на кнопку “Добавить действие” → Выбираем “Картинка/Видео/Аудио”, вставляем и форматируем текст, добавляем картинку/видео/аудио → Сохраняем.
    • Файл – если кроме текста нужно вставить файл.
    Как работает: Нажимаем в рубрике на кнопку “Добавить действие” → Выбираем “Файл”, вставляем и форматируем текст, добавляем файл → Сохраняем.
    • “Текстовый выбор” – если в сообщении нужны кнопки.
    Как работает: Нажимаем в рубрике на кнопку “Добавить действие” → Выбираем “Текстовый выбор”, вставляем и форматируем текст, добавляем файл (по желанию), заполняем кнопки выбора, настраиваем переход к следующему действию от каждой кнопки → Сохраняем.

    Ещё одно действие, которое пригодится – “Переход к рубрике“. Оно нужно, чтобы переключать информацию пользователю от 1 рубрике ко 2, от 4 к 1 и тд.
    Как работает: Нажимаем в рубрике на кнопку “Добавить действие” → Выбираем “Переход к рубрике”, выбираем к какой рубрике настроить переход → Сохраняем.
  8. Далее нам нужно зарегистрировать пользователя на мероприятие, есть 2 варианта:

    1 – создаём Google Форму и через действие “Текстовое поле” просто даём ссылку для регистрации.
    • Далее создаём второе действие “Текстовый выбор” с текстом, например, “Нажмите кнопку, когда заполните форму”.
    • Далее настраиваем сигнал (уведомление) на почту по инструкции (см. конец инструкции).

    Совет: Если вы выбрали данный метод и ссылка для регистрации для каждого мероприятия отдельная, то эти действия настраиваем в каждой рубрике из пункта 7, проверяя правильность ссылки. Если ссылка одна и та же, то можно создать отдельную рубрику и настроить переход на неё из всех рубрик из пункта 7.

    2 – создаём ещё одну рубрику и называем её “Сбор контактных данных“. Здесь мы настроим запрос ФИО и номера телефона пользователя для регистрации:
    • В пункте 4 мы создали переменные данные для ФИО, осталось создать действие:
    Нажимаем на кнопку “Добавить действие” Выбираем “Переменные данные: добавление/редактирование” Редактируем действие: называем его, задаём текст (например, “напишите ваше ФИО”) → Выбираем переменные данные куда будет сохраняться ответ пользователя → Пишем сообщение, которое идет после ввода данных пользователем (например, “Спасибо, мы сохранили”) → Сохраняем.
    • Далее запрашиваем номер телефона:
    Создаём новое действие → Выбираем тип действия “Запросить номер телефона/email” → Редактируем действие: называем кнопку, вставляем по желанию текст Сохраняем.
    • Далее настраиваем сигнал (уведомление) на почту по инструкции (см. конец инструкции).

    Важно: Не забудьте настроить переход на данную рубрику из всех рубрик из пункта 7.
  9. Добавляем в группу пользователей, которые зарегистрировались на мероприятие, чтобы потом отправить им напоминание:
    В верхнем меню выбираем “Группы” Кликаем на “Добавить группу пользователей” Редактируем: задаём имя (например, “Записались на мероприятие по маркетингу”), описание (по желанию), выбираем рубрики, которые будут доступны пользователям Сохраняем.
  10. Настраиваем напоминания о мероприятии:
    В верхнем меню нажимаем на “Маркетинг” Кликаем на “Автоматические рассылки” Нажимаем на кнопку “Создать рассылку” Редактируем: даём название, выбираем группу рассылок “Записались на мероприятие по маркетингу”, тип рассылок “Стандартная” Нажимаем кнопку “Создать рассылку” Нажимаем на созданную рассылку, чтобы задать сообщение Нажимаем кнопку “Создать сообщение” Редактируем: вставляем текст, ссылки, картинки/файлы по желанию и настраиваем время отправки Сохраняем сообщение.
  11. Настраиваем запрос отзыва о мероприятии: инструкция.

Создание чат-бота для анонсов мероприятий и записи на них — отличный способ упростить процесс регистрации и улучшить взаимодействие с участниками. С помощью конструктора BotBrother вы сможете быстро настроить бота, который будет автоматизировать процесс анонса мероприятий, собирать заявки и отправлять напоминания.

В результате вы получите эффективного помощника для своего бизнеса или проекта, который сэкономит время как организаторов, так и участников.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*